what characterized the soviet state

Respuesta :

albertoaleman
albertoaleman albertoaleman
  • 17-03-2020

Answer:

A totalitarian political system with one-party rule, with no competitive democratic elections. The Soviet state was also characterized by a central command economy with no private property, no private companies and all major economic decisions were made by bureaucrats in charge of a planning system, and the state made all decisions on prices and allocation of resources in the economy.
